解决 MySQL 数据库无法启动的问题
在进行网站开发和管理时,MySQL数据库是必不可少的一个关键组件。但是,有时候MySQL启动失败,可能会给我们的工作带来一些困扰。在这篇文章中,我们将探讨一些常见的问题和解决方法,以确保无论何时,我们都能够启动MySQL数据库。mysql下载不了怎么办
1. 检查MySQL日志文件
当MySQL启动失败时,第一步是检查MySQL错误日志文件。在Linux系统下,日志文件通常存储在/var/log/mysql/error.log或/var/log/mysqld.log中。在Windows系统下,通常在C:\Program Files\MySQL Server\data\或C:\ProgramData\MySQL\MySQL Server X.Y\data\中。打开这些文件,查看错误信息,这可以帮助我们了解可能导致MySQL启动失败的原因。错误信息可能是与文件权限、网络连接、配置文件等相关的。
2. 检查MySQL配置文件
MySQL的配置文件(myf或my.ini)是启动MySQL的关键。在Linux下,这个文件通常存储在/etc/mysql/myf或/etc/myf目录下。在Windows下,这个文件通常存储在C:\Program F
iles\MySQL\MySQL Server X.Y\my.ini或C:\ProgramData\MySQL\MySQL Server X.Y\my.ini目录下。
观察配置文件是否存在任何语法错误或不正确的配置项。特别是检查各种目录是否设置正确,例如binlog的目录、socket的目录和pid file的目录等。如果配置文件中的错误使MySQL无法启动,将配置文件还原为备份文件,或者尝试重新编写该文件以解决语法问题。
3. 杀死旧版MySQL实例
如果MySQL停止之前没有正确地关闭,则不会释放MySQL进程。因此,当我们尝试重新启动它时,它会检测到现有的MySQL进程正在运行,并且拒绝启动一个新的进程。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论